Transaction 08ab2cfbae9d8e0be61a6675b5b63c39f7fb76885760816c19287382e116e43d
1 Input
2 Outputs
- 08ab2cfbae9d8e0be61a6675b5b63c39f7fb76885760816c19287382e116e43d:0
- 08ab2cfbae9d8e0be61a6675b5b63c39f7fb76885760816c19287382e116e43d:1
value 344000511
address 1DhbdjMwAcAq4AHXAZfcpj8jSvygs6mdQF
value 1254800000
address 3QqaAXnKHTnsWHuAudD5bdnH2GP7zW2GS2